Commit Graph

149 Commits

Author SHA1 Message Date
aj
849c0a5fa6 added frontend for last.fm username updating
fixed password updating
changed password statuses from text to toast
added maths menu item
2019-10-19 17:57:56 +01:00
aj
77a7583913 refactored to music package 2019-10-19 17:14:11 +01:00
aj
2a16f2b476 added sort endpoint 2019-10-10 11:58:17 +01:00
aj
d6bff0f9bd added fmframework, added count and daily scrobbles endpoint 2019-10-07 12:21:26 +01:00
aj
694add7f8a updated links 2019-10-04 20:46:52 +01:00
aj
d9a2ba9829 spotframework api refactor 2019-10-03 00:59:07 +01:00
aj
59d073f666 updated variable names, added to auth process, added device_name to player 2019-10-01 19:20:22 +01:00
aj
0a72b4678f added player blueprint, fixed decorators 2019-09-30 14:19:00 +01:00
aj
d0adcc679b added get authed network function to reduce token refreshing, added play endpoint 2019-09-27 10:32:42 +01:00
aj
215c839210 added basic auth api support, added device name specification in play 2019-09-25 19:28:38 +01:00
aj
5909229d69 updated to playlist engine sources framework, added library tracks backend support 2019-09-23 23:12:26 +01:00
aj
9d763be6c1 added request decorators and function annotations 2019-09-16 02:22:58 +01:00
aj
e23bd811cb added handling for empty playlist response 2019-09-15 23:17:17 +01:00
aj
dfeb1555c8 migrated to uri id base 2019-09-15 15:33:29 +01:00
aj
0cc962cf0d handling optional access key, added player 2019-09-15 03:34:00 +01:00
aj
435f16b779 fix for -1 reference handling 2019-09-12 09:59:00 +01:00
aj
13ebc8a1e8 added filter framework, migrated to processor package 2019-09-05 15:51:42 +01:00
aj
6602bea645 separated spotframework from web front, centralized logging init 2019-09-05 12:20:21 +01:00
aj
c003065419 added playlist printing, model props, added popularity sorting 2019-09-05 11:42:35 +01:00
aj
7f5c7709af fully objectified model 2019-09-04 17:45:25 +01:00
aj
20939400de added loading for playlist view 2019-09-03 19:01:43 +01:00
aj
3bb7ac663a migrated playlist reference storage to object references as opposed to name strings 2019-08-27 00:13:42 +01:00
aj
1ac189ca7a Merge remote-tracking branch 'origin/master' 2019-08-26 18:31:46 +01:00
aj
5e2951c9fe fixed alphabetical sort, added part_generator 2019-08-26 18:31:21 +01:00
aj
ec72540f67 tweaked ui look (navbar and sidebar), changed button shape 2019-08-23 01:01:08 +01:00
aj
54258d7126 added description overwrite and suffix support 2019-08-19 00:52:02 +01:00
aj
42e0a8c22c added front end support for optional month playlists 2019-08-18 09:43:48 +01:00
aj
ebbf374ae7 improved logging, added support for optional this month/last month 2019-08-17 18:30:13 +01:00
aj
c8e7d752ac fixed playlist creation id handling 2019-08-14 22:57:58 +01:00
aj
dcfd197d93 added play scratch pad 2019-08-12 00:34:04 +01:00
aj
57408efcda imported spotframework, utilising for running playlists locally 2019-08-10 17:53:50 +01:00
aj
7272379a9c migrated to asynchronous tasks for staggering user and users playlist execution 2019-08-08 12:25:53 +01:00
aj
61ac85d41f check for spotify auth on run, updated helper text 2019-08-08 00:18:41 +01:00
aj
f1dcf6fdd6 fixed duplicate name detection 2019-08-07 16:22:31 +01:00
aj
94dda91dd1 added toast messages 2019-08-05 22:55:07 +01:00
aj
daf80b5c0b api code stability 2019-08-05 21:43:09 +01:00
aj
dcc4725047 added recommendations and select ref from dropdown 2019-08-05 18:29:46 +01:00
aj
c50a666a4d added playlist_references 2019-08-04 02:11:33 +01:00
aj
2b0b094cf1 added cron job handler and admin run all function 2019-08-03 23:36:14 +01:00
aj
79392fd34d added register, admin lock functions 2019-08-03 21:35:08 +01:00
aj
ccc98c0f3e button styling, adding recents boundary box 2019-08-03 12:10:24 +01:00
aj
625ba9b614 updated requirements 2019-08-02 14:03:20 +01:00
aj
0d92d6b244 added new spotify playlist on new and redirect 2019-08-02 12:54:18 +01:00
aj
84bbcc21fc add and delete playlists, spotify auth 2019-07-31 20:31:01 +01:00
aj
e3615d0ccf integrated spotify auth/deauth, adding parts to playlist 2019-07-31 12:24:10 +01:00
aj
6617160c75 added change password, style updates, api updates 2019-07-30 16:25:01 +01:00
aj
14a3c0bab1 added log in, session and started on api 2019-07-29 11:44:10 +01:00
aj
aaebf3a6e9 added js frontend skeleton with routing 2019-07-26 14:18:32 +01:00
aj
549d8b4e10 initial commit with first pass backend 2019-07-26 11:05:27 +01:00